A gang saw is a multi-blade machine that cuts stone blocks into slabs in one pass. Standard industrial route from block to slab before finishing.
A waterjet cutting machine uses high-pressure water (often with abrasive) for precise decorative stone cutting. Equipment/process language, not a product grade.
A kerf anchor engages a slot (kerf) cut into stone for cladding support. Fixing hardware language used with façade systems.
A grout float is a tool used to spread and force grout into tile joints. Installation tool language, not a stone product grade.
A stone anchor is a mechanical fixing that secures cladding or components to the structure. System design covers loads, kerfs, and corrosion. Installation hardware, not a surface finish.
A wet saw is a water-cooled powered saw for cutting stone or tile. Equipment language for fabrication and installation shops.
